Cómo usar n8n: guía avanzada para dominar la automatización visual sin código

  • n8n permite crear flujos automáticos personalizados con una interfaz visual intuitiva y código abierto.
  • La flexibilidad de instalación (nube, servidor propio, Docker) y control total de datos son ventajas clave frente a otras plataformas.
  • Integraciones avanzadas con IA, manejo de errores, escalabilidad y soporte comunitario convierten a n8n en la solución ideal para empresas y usuarios exigentes.

Cómo usar n8n

Hoy en día, la automatización se ha convertido en la clave para agilizar tareas y maximizar la productividad, tanto en empresas como en el día a día personal. Si llevas tiempo escuchando acerca de la facilidad con la que puedes ahorrar tiempo, evitar errores y sincronizar aplicaciones mediante flujos sencillos, seguro que has oído hablar de n8n. Sin embargo, más allá del ruido mediático, ¿qué es n8n exactamente y cómo puedes sacarle el máximo partido, incluso si no programas?

Si tienes la sensación de que podrías estar dejando escapar la oportunidad de hacer tu vida (y la de tu equipo) mucho más eficiente, este artículo te interesa. Vamos a adentrarnos en todo lo que necesitas saber sobre n8n usando el conocimiento experto y práctico recopilado de los contenidos mejor posicionados en la web: qué es la herramienta, cómo funciona su sistema de nodos y flujos, cómo instalarla en local, configurar tu primer automatismo y sacarle jugo a integraciones con IA y otras plataformas populares, además de consejos, ejemplos y buenas prácticas para que evites los errores de los principiantes.

¿Qué es n8n y por qué todo el mundo habla de automatización open source?

n8n (que se pronuncia en-eight-en) es una solución de automatización visual y modular que permite diseñar flujos de trabajo integrando cientos de aplicaciones y servicios sin necesidad de tener conocimientos avanzados de programación. Su filosofía open source significa que puedes utilizar la herramienta en la nube o instalarla en tu propio servidor con costes controlados y sin ataduras a modelos cerrados de suscripción. Te olvidas así de complicaciones legales o de privacidad, ya que todo está bajo tu control. Para ampliar tus conocimientos sobre herramientas de visualización y monitorización, también puedes consultar qué es Grafana.

La gran baza de n8n es su enfoque visual mediante nodos: cada nodo equivale a una acción (recibir un correo, enviar un mensaje, extraer información de un PDF, hacer una consulta HTTP, etc.) que puedes encadenar de forma intuitiva en un lienzo interactivo. Imagina un tablero donde cada pieza representa una tarea, todas conectadas entre sí de la manera más lógica para evitar pasos manuales y errores humanos. Todo esto soporta tanto escenarios sencillos (avisos por email, recopilar leads de formularios) como flujos complejos con integración de inteligencia artificial, procesamiento de datos y transformaciones avanzadas.

¿Por qué elegir n8n frente a alternativas como Zapier, Make o Power Automate?

El ecosistema de automatización está cada vez más competido. Herramientas como Zapier, Make.com o Power Automate de Microsoft han democratizado la automatización para usuarios sin experiencia en desarrollo. Sin embargo, n8n sobresale en varios puntos fundamentales que no debes perder de vista si buscas una opción flexible y escalable:

  • Código abierto y autoalojamiento gratuito: Puedes desplegar una instancia en tu servidor, VPS, contenedor Docker o incluso en un Raspberry Pi, sin que tengas que pagar por cada operación ni depender del proveedor.
  • Control total sobre los datos: Especialmente relevante si gestionas información sensible o necesitas cumplir con normativas de protección de datos. Nadie accede a tus flujos ni tus bases de datos.
  • Menos limitaciones rígidas: Mientras otras plataformas ponen topes por número de tareas, usuarios o conexiones, n8n te da libertad para escalar según el crecimiento de tu empresa o proyecto.
  • Integración nativa de agentes de IA y de conectores personalizados, sumando valor frente a flujos demasiado sencillos o predefinidos.
  • Curva de aprendizaje moderada pero muchas más posibilidades: Si buscas simplemente automatizar algo típico de oficina, Zapier es rápido. Pero si quieres personalización real y resolver procesos con lógica avanzada, n8n se lleva la palma.
  • Plantillas y extensiones compartidas por una comunidad activa, así como la opción de desarrollar tus propios nodos en JavaScript o Python.

¿Cómo funciona n8n? Desgranando la interfaz y los conceptos clave

El funcionamiento interno de n8n es lo que marca la diferencia respecto a otras opciones. Su editor visual (canvas) te permite arrastrar y conectar nodos de diferentes tipos. Cada nodo cumple una función: desencadenantes para empezar el flujo, acciones concretas (llamar a APIs, enviar emails, modificar hojas, etc.), transformadores de datos, y nodos de control (condiciones, bifurcaciones, bucles, reintentos). Para comprender mejor el flujo, también puedes consultar y su utilidad en dashboards de control.

Conceptos imprescindibles para dominar n8n:

  • Workflow (flujo de trabajo): secuencia automatizada completa que resuelve un proceso desde el disparador hasta el resultado.
  • Node (nodo): paso o acción concreta (lectura, transformación o envío de datos).
  • Disparador (Trigger): punto de inicio; puede ser un webhook, un cron programado, la llegada de un email, la actualización de un Google Sheet, etc.
  • Credenciales: información segura de acceso a las aplicaciones o servicios conectados.
  • Ejecuciones: instancia completa de un flujo funcionando con datos reales, donde puedes analizar entradas y salidas para depurar el proceso.
  • Datos JSON: n8n utiliza este formato de datos entre nodos, lo que simplifica tanto la depuración como la integración con APIs o bases externas.

La lógica de trabajo se basa en una cadena de pasos muy similar a las tuberías de datos de un programador, pero llevada a un entorno visual accesible. Puedes combinar nodos de acción con nodos de transformación, añadiendo expresiones o snippets de código si buscas personalización extra sin abandonar la interfaz gráfica.

Instalación de n8n: nube, Docker, servidor propio y otras opciones

Aquí tienes la gran ventaja competitiva de n8n: puedes empezar en minutos y ajustar el grado de control según tus necesidades.

  • Versión alojada (cloud): basta con registrarte en la nube desde la web oficial de y comenzar a usar su editor web.
  • Instalación en servidor propio: opción recomendada para empresas, equipos que requieren control y usuarios técnicos. Puedes usar:
    • Docker: método más simple y estable, ideal para aislamiento y facilidad de actualizaciones.
    • NPM/Node.js: disponible, aunque menos recomendable por posibles conflictos y mantenimiento más delicado. Genial para entornos personales o quienes ya usen Node.js habitualmente.
    • VPS (Virtual Private Server): Hostinger, Raiola Networks y otros proveedores facilitan el despliegue rápido en servicios virtualizados, con tarifas económicas para proyectos que empiezan o entornos de pruebas.
    • Raspberry Pi/ordenador personal: alternativa gratuita para quienes quieren probar sus posibilidades antes de apostar por infraestructura.
  • Modelo híbrido: valida tu flujo en la nube y, cuando requieras funcionalidad avanzada o mayor control, migra a una instancia en tu infraestructura.

Consejo clave: elige la opción más sencilla para empezar y afina más adelante. El objetivo es poner un piloto en marcha e iterar sobre él con ciclos cortos. Cuantos menos obstáculos técnicos al inicio, mejor.

Licencia y limitaciones de uso

n8n funciona bajo la licencia Sustainable Use License, una fórmula de «código abierto justo» (fair-code), gratuita para proyectos internos, cursos, equipos pequeños y casos personales, pero con restricciones para reventa de servicios o uso intensivo comercial sin contribuir al desarrollo. El soporte oficial solo se incluye en los planes de pago de la versión cloud, aunque la comunidad y los foros son muy activos para resolver dudas y compartir recursos.

Configuración inicial: creando tu primer flujo en n8n

Entrar en n8n por primera vez es mucho menos intimidante de lo que parece si entiendes las piezas básicas:

  • El editor visual/canvas: zona donde arrastras nodos y creas la “tubería” de tu flujo.
  • Disparador (trigger): escoge el evento o punto de inicio (correo, webhook, horario programado…)
  • Acciones/nodos: cada uno representa una tarea, desde leer un campo hasta consultar una API, filtrar información o disparar envíos de correo.
  • Transformaciones: ayudan a limpiar y adaptar los datos para su siguiente paso (muy útil al trabajar con formatos como JSON, fechas o nombres inconsistentes).
  • Testeo y ejecución segura: prueba la automatización con ejemplos reales antes de ponerla en producción.

El objetivo de este primer flujo es muy básico: recibir datos, transformarlos y obtener un resultado visible (por ejemplo, añadir una nueva fila en un Google Sheets o enviar un mensaje a Slack). Deja registradas dos métricas clave: minutos ahorrados en la tarea y porcentaje de ejecuciones exitosas (para detectar cuellos de botella o errores tempranos).

Ejemplo básico: del formulario web a tu hoja de cálculo

  • Trigger: webhook que recibe datos desde un formulario online.
  • Transformación: normalizar campos, validar que los datos requeridos existen y asegurar formatos adecuados (email, fecha, etc.).
  • Salida: añadir los datos validados a una hoja de Google Sheets, enviando a la vez un aviso por correo o Slack.

Puedes consultar una muestra de configuración de este escenario en el blog de OpenWebinars, donde verás el paso a paso con cada nodo necesario y enlaces entre ellos.

Profundizando: nodos avanzados, control de errores y lógica compleja

Dominar los nodos básicos es solo el comienzo. Una de las grandes diferencias de n8n frente a Zapier o Make es la facilidad para añadir lógica avanzada, control de errores, transformaciones complejas y bifurcaciones sin salir del entorno visual. Así, puedes cubrir:

  • Condiciones: lógica tipo “si esto, haz lo otro” para segmentar datos o gestionar excepciones.
  • Bifurcaciones y bucles: procesa listas de datos, distribuye tareas o divide rutas según reglas.
  • Manejo de errores y reintentos: reintenta automáticamente pasos en los que la API externa falla temporalmente y envía alertas al equipo si se produce un error crítico.
  • Alertas inteligentes: avisos automáticos con información contextual (ID de ejecución, datos relevantes) por canal de preferencia (correo, SMS, Telegram, Slack, Teams, etc.).
  • Logging y métricas: monitoriza resultados, tasa de éxito, tiempo por ejecución y volumen de tareas para decidir cuándo mejorar el flujo o escalar la infraestructura.

El control de flujo y la gestión de errores te permiten diferenciar una automatización “demo” de un proceso real y mantenible con menos sorpresas y más fiabilidad a largo plazo.

Casos de uso reales y ejemplos prácticos: sácale partido a n8n desde el primer día

Los escenarios de uso de n8n son prácticamente ilimitados, tanto en el mundo empresarial como en proyectos personales. Aquí tienes algunos de los más habituales, todos extrapolados de casos y guías de las webs líderes:

  • Notificaciones automatizadas: avisa al equipo (por Slack, mail, SMS) cada vez que se realiza un pedido, se detecta una incidencia o se produce un evento relevante en tus sistemas.
  • Sincronización de datos entre plataformas: sincroniza información entre tu CRM y plataforma de proyectos, elimina duplicados y asegura coherencia entre sistemas dispares.
  • Procesamiento de facturas y pagos: automatiza la recepción, parsing y validación de pagos, reintenta cobros y genera facturas, integrando servicios antifraude.
  • Resúmenes e informes automáticos: recopila datos de diferentes fuentes, elabora informes semanales/mensuales y distribúyelos antes de cada reunión sin intervención manual.
  • Web scraping y recopilación de información: extrae datos de fuentes online, monitoriza precios, competencia, presencia mediática o tendencias en tiempo real y guarda los resultados en hojas o bases de datos.
  • Automatización doméstica y domótica: controla luces, calefacción o puertas en casa mediante nodos de eventos y reglas personalizadas según ubicación o presencia.

Integración con inteligencia artificial: llevando la automatización al siguiente nivel

Uno de los puntos fuertes de n8n en 2024 y 2025 es la excelente integración de agentes de IA y modelos como OpenAI, Claude o Hugging Face en flujos automáticos de empresa o personales. ¿Qué puedes hacer con la IA integrada en n8n?

  • Clasificación automática: determina automáticamente la categoría de los emails, documentos o tickets entrantes y decide qué hacer en cada caso.
  • Resúmenes inteligentes: resume textos, actas de reuniones o documentos complejos y distribúyelos a los responsables correspondientes.
  • Extracción de campos clave: analiza PDF, facturas, presupuestos recibidos por email y extrae importes, fechas o conceptos clave para archivarlos y auditarlos.
  • Toma de decisiones automatizadas: los agentes de IA pueden ejecutar reglas, responder a clientes, filtrar y limpiar bases de datos o detectar anomalías en tiempo real.
  • Activación de chatbots y asistentes virtuales personalizados: mediante llamadas a APIs de lenguaje o nodos HTTP.

¿Cómo integro la IA en mi flujo? Puedes añadir nodos específicos de IA (por ejemplo, conexión directa con OpenAI, clasificación de texto, generación de respuestas, etc.) o usar el nodo HTTP para conectarte a cualquier endpoint de inteligencia artificial, personalizando prompts y respuestas según tu lógica.

Ventajas y contras de n8n frente a la competencia: escoge el sistema adecuado según tu caso

No existe una herramienta perfecta para todos los colores. Aquí tienes los puntos comparativos más sólidos extraídos de Hostinger, Raiola Networks, Coderhouse y otras fuentes de calidad:

  • Ventajas sobre Zapier: Zapier es ideal para principiantes por facilidad y variedad de integraciones, pero n8n destaca por la posibilidad de autoalojamiento, ausencia de límites estrictos y capacidad para flujos avanzados o integraciones personalizadas.
  • Ventajas sobre Make.com: Make.com (antes Integromat) tiene más conectores listos y un enfoque muy visual, pero la flexibilidad de n8n en lógica avanzada, extensión por código y IA es superior para usuarios que buscan saltar la barrera del plug-and-play.
  • Ventajas sobre Power Automate: si trabajas toda la infraestructura en Microsoft 365, Power Automate es muy efectivo. Pero para empresas mixtas o ampliaciones futuras, n8n ofrece más neutralidad y control granular.
  • Inconvenientes de n8n: menor número de integraciones predefinidas respecto a los grandes players, curva de aprendizaje algo más pronunciada y más atención técnica en la configuración inicial.

La elección depende de tu contexto: ¿Valoras el control, la escalabilidad y la personalización? Prioriza n8n. ¿Buscas solución rápida y fácil? Zapier puede valer, sobre todo si trabajas con apps muy populares y lógica simple.

Escalado, rendimiento y gestión de costes

Uno de los temores habituales al automatizar es que el precio se dispare según el volumen de tareas y usuarios. Aquí, n8n ofrece ventajas claras:

  • Autoalojamiento = control total del gasto. Solo pagas el servidor donde montes tu instancia y su mantenimiento. Sin coste por operaciones ni límites estrictos.
  • Capacidad para clusters y multi-instancia, garantizando rendimiento adecuado para proyectos empresariales y operaciones de alto tráfico. Puedes pasar de 200 a miles de tareas por segundo si dimensionas bien tu infraestructura.
  • Herramientas de benchmarking, plantillas de monitorización y métrica, así como alertas proactivas para ajustar la configuración cuando la carga crece.
  • Disponibilidad de planes cloud para quienes prefieran externalizar la gestión del servidor (desde 20 € al mes, con límites adaptables).
  • Modelos híbridos/híbridos: empieza en la nube y migra solo las tareas críticas o de más volumen a tu entorno para contener el coste al escalar.

Buenas prácticas y errores comunes: cómo evitar sustos y mantener tus flujos robustos

Automatizar requiere rigor y control aunque trabajes con sistemas low-code. Evita tropezar con estos consejos extraídos de las mejores guías:

  • Diseña para lo mínimo viable: empieza por un caso corto y medible, con un único camino crítico. Añade ramas o mejoras solo cuando el flujo demuestre su valor.
  • Nomenclatura clara y trazable: utiliza prefijos coherentes para tipos de nodos (TRG_ para triggers, SET_ para normalizaciones, OUT_ para salidas) y descripciones breves en cada paso.
  • Credenciales bajo control: define accesos mínimos para cada servicio, evita cuentas personales compartidas y usa variables de entorno para secretos o tokens; nunca pegues claves sensibles en claro.
  • Manejo de errores (reintentos, ramas de excepción, mensajes de alerta); así conviertes un fallo en una incidencia menor, sin bloquear ni escalar al equipo entero.
  • Trabaja siempre con datos reales/sanitizados en lugar de ejemplos irreales; prueba paginación, caracteres especiales y adjuntos para evitar sorpresas al pasar a producción.
  • Documenta dentro del flujo (descripción clara y notas en nodos) y usa control de versiones si cambias procesos frecuentemente.
  • Prioriza la seguridad: actualiza la plataforma con regularidad, utiliza roles y permisos adecuados, aplica cifrado y autenticación OAuth2 siempre que puedas.
  • No sobredimensiones ni caigas en la alerta fácil: evita flujos que pretendan resolverlo todo de golpe o notificaciones que saturen a los usuarios, pues así la automatización pierde impacto.

Soporte, comunidad y recursos de aprendizaje

n8n ha cultivado una comunidad internacional entusiasta y práctica, con especial crecimiento en español. Esto te garantiza una amplia variedad de recursos:

  • Más de 1300 plantillas y ejemplos de flujos gratuitos y de pago en el sitio oficial
  • Foros oficiales y Discord: ayuda rápida y colaborativa, tanto de otros usuarios como del equipo de n8n.
  • Centros de ayuda y documentación actualizada en castellano y otros idiomas.
  • Tutoriales, vídeos en YouTube y canales de formación especializados.
  • Guías completas y cursos en plataformas reconocidas como Visual Studio Code y DismTools. Muchas ofrecen seguimiento y resolución de dudas en escenarios reales de negocio.

Si ya trabajas con otras plataformas de automatización (Make, Flowise, AgentBuilder, etc.), la curva de aprendizaje te resultará mucho más suave. La lógica por nodos y flujos es similar, por lo que puedes reutilizar ideas y módulos entre sistemas.

Preguntas frecuentes sobre el uso de n8n

  • ¿n8n es realmente gratuito? Sí, puedes usar la versión open source y autoalojada sin coste salvo el servidor. Solo escalarás a la cloud de pago si tu proyecto lo requiere.
  • ¿Necesito saber programar? No. La mayoría de flujos se hacen arrastrando y conectando nodos visualmente. Solo te hará falta código si tienes necesidades ultra personalizadas (y aun así, puedes copiar/pegar ejemplos de la comunidad).
  • ¿Qué diferencia a n8n de otras herramientas? Su condición de open source, flexibilidad y facilidad para crear integraciones personalizadas y entornos autoalojados.
  • ¿Puedo trabajar con IA y automatización avanzada? Totalmente. Puedes conectar APIs de IA (OpenAI, Claude, Hugging Face), generar agentes y tomar decisiones automatizadas en función de los resultados.
  • ¿Qué ocurre si tengo un atasco técnico? El soporte oficial está reservado para versiones de pago, pero tendrás ayuda rápida en foros, Discord y grupos de Telegram. Si usas un proveedor como Hostinger o Raiola, el soporte se limita a la infraestructura, no a la plataforma, aunque siempre tendrás documentación y recursos para salir del paso.

Dominar n8n es más que aprender una herramienta: supone adoptar una mentalidad de mejora continua orientada a procesos replicables y sostenibles. La automatización no es solo un atajo, sino una forma de trabajar de manera más inteligente, liberando tiempo y recursos para aquellas tareas en las que realmente aportas valor.

Deja un comentario